The operation of a flat belt drive (though not obvious) is that the pulleys have a crown on them. This crown may be only a few thousandths of an inch on a 2.5 wide pulley, however it may be as much as .250" on a wide large pulley used on a threshing machine. The belt (either flat or v running on flat pulleys) always seaks the highest fattest part of the pulley. The edge of the belt sees the larger diameter in that direction and climbs it, just like a car's steering will pull toward the edges of a wear groove on the highway.
The task of aligning a belt system is easier than it appears due to the design of the pulleys and the principle of operation. Flat belts are more efficient than V belts when designed correctly. V belts have far more parasitic friction as the belt wedges into the groove. Flat belts do not. V belts self distruct when confronted with load slippage, flats do not (they usually come off, providing a "mechanical fuse" in the mechanism).
